200 litres of a mixture contains 15% water and the rest is milk. The amount of milk that must be added so that the resulting mixture contains 87.5% milk is:
1. 45 litres
2. 40 litres
3. 35 litres
4. 30 litres

Correct Answer - Option 2 : 40 litres

Given:

A mixture contains = 200 litres 

Water = 15% 

The amount of milk that must be added so that the resulting mixture contains  87.5% milk is ;

Calculation :

The initial amount of milk = 85/100 ×  200 = 170 litres 

Let the amount of milk to be added be = a

The new amount of milk = a + 170 litres  

The total amount of mixture becomes = 200 + a

We express the new quantity of milk as a percentage of the total  mixture as follows.

⇒ (a + 170) / (a + 200) × 100 = 87.5

⇒ 100a + 17000 = 87.5a + 17500

⇒ 100a - 87.5a = 17500 - 17000 

⇒ 12.5a = 500 

⇒ a = 40

∴ The milk is 40 litres.
